Mount Kenya Safari 8 days
The journey to Mount Kenya will take 8 days and seven nights; this mountain is the second highest mountain in Africa. Like Mount Kilimanjaro, it is an extinct volcano. It dominates the Central Kenyan highlands, towering just 70 miles north of Nairobi and ten miles south of the equator. The mountain was once higher than Mount Everest but today it is a large dome, roughly 60 miles in diameter from which the rise steep has eroded the remains of its volcanic core. The summit is actually a twin summit, a pair of rocky snow-capped peaks, Batian 5199m and 17,057 ft, and Nelion 5188m and17,021 ft, only separated by a narrow gap and surrounded by an intricate system of peaks and ridges with many high glaciers.
Making it a more technically difficult mountain to climb than Kilimanjaro,
Mount Kenya offers some of Africa's finest rock and ice climbing. Huts
for accommodation are available along the most common routes but the more
serious routes may require bivouacs. The mountain is heavily forested
and its ecological diversity is one of its primary attractions. A variety
of plant life grows on the slopes including camphor, cedar, and bamboo
while elephants, rhinos, buffalos, and leopards roam the surrounding areas.
Though there are various routes; the Sirimon-Chogoria route is the most
relaxed and gradual. It is accessible to most and does not require any
technical climbing gear or knowledge.

Day 03: Old Moses
After and early breakfast, the day starts with a 9 km hiking trip that
starts from Sirimon Gate and finishes at Old Moses. You will enjoy the
walk through the verdant highland rainforest line with Giant Cedar and
Podocarpus vegetation along the route. Large mammals are generally seen
on any day while elephants and buffaloes are spotted by only half of the
climbers. Dinner and Overnight at Old Moses with an altitude range of
3300m above sea level.
Day 04: Old Moses - Shipton's Camp
After and early breakfast continue to climb and a significant altitude
is covered by today. Majority of the trekkers can climb up to this place
in 5 to 6 hours. The first part of the climb is steep before descending
into the Mackinders Valley. You will come across ravishing views as you
leave the vegetation zone and enter the tundra zone. Dinner and Overnight
at Shipton's Camp at an altitude range of 4200 m above sea level.
Day 05: Shipton's Camp
By this day you will have been used to the changed climatic conditions
before climbing further. A short ascent is made to Kami Hut at an altitude
of 4350 m where you will love the appealing alpine lakes, pretty pools
and protruding rock formations. Return back to Shipton's Camp for dinner
and an overnight stay. Shipton's Camp, Mount Kenya Safari
Day 06: Shipton's Camp - Pt. Lenana - Chogoria Bandas
This journey is interesting because it takes three hours and starts in
the middle of the night so that we can reach Pt. Lenana with an altitude
of 4985 m before the sunrise. Most climbers are able to reach here before
the sunrise at 6.30 am. On a clear day, one can easily get enamored by
the sights of Mt Kilimanjaro in the south, Mount Elgon in the west and
Indian Ocean in the East. The return begins before the beginning of the
wind that generally starts after the sunrise followed by dense mist and
cloud cover which would make the return unpredictable and perilous. Take
a break at Minos Hut for breakfast. Continue the return to Chogoria Bandas
for dinner and overnight stay (picnic lunch en-route).
